
Jaguar Mining Inc has seen a notable uptick in its stock price, closing the last trading session with a gain of over 4%.
On the Toronto Stock Exchange, Jaguar Mining Inc (JAG.TO) experienced a significant rise of 4.04% in its stock price, closing at CA$5.67. This increase comes amid strong performance indicators and strategic developments within the company, signaling a positive outlook for investors.

Jaguar Mining Inc Rises 4.04% in One Day
With a market cap of CA$441 million, Jaguar Mining's stock performance stands out, especially in a volatile gold market.
Bull case
Jaguar Mining has successfully restarted the Turmalina Mine and reported strong Q1 earnings, positioning the company well in a favorable gold market. This could lead to sustained growth and profitability.
Bear case
Despite the positive movement, Jaguar Mining's negative profit margin reveals underlying challenges that could impact long-term performance if not addressed.

Recent Performance Highlights
Jaguar Mining's stock performance has been boosted by strong earnings reports and operational improvements. The successful restart of the Turmalina Mine has played a key role in its recent success, coinciding with rising gold prices that have attracted investor interest.
Market Context and Future Outlook
As gold prices remain robust, Jaguar Mining is well-positioned to take advantage of these market conditions. However, investors should stay cautious about the company's current negative profit margin, highlighting the need for continued operational efficiency and profitability.
